					<description><![CDATA[I can’t even begin to tell you how close to home this hits. I gave birth to a son in April of this year, and we planned for an unmedicated hospital birth throughout the entire pregnancy. We had a midwife. We hired a doula. We took all the classes, and read all the books. I, too, was terrified of being a plus sized expectant mother. In fact, it’s the only reason I wasn’t ecstatic about our little surprise. However, like you, I also had a nearly perfect pregnancy. I felt better than ever. I went to 41 weeks and 3 days when my water broke without being in labor. There was meconium in my water, so they had to start Pitocin to induce. This was not part of our plan, nor was having an on call doctor we had never met. After 26 hours of hard, Pitocin filled, no pain medicine labor (the epidural failed…twice), I still hadn’t progressed past 5cm despite max level Pitocin and all my doula and I had done to get the baby to drop. I finally caved and asked for a C-Section. Our perfectly healthy baby boy ended up being almost 11lbs. He was never going to come out on his own. Even though I knew it was necessary, I just recently made peace with not having my ideal birth. My milk also never came in which was a whole other added layer of heart break. I still have my moments where the sadness over my birth experience and inability to breast feed hits me, but I’m mostly just thankful for our perfect son. Stories like this help tremendously to know I’m not alone. Thank you! ♥️]]></description>
